| Aggro | Aggressive |
| 'Agro' | Australian icon, children's TV puppet, made from a bathmat! |
| Akubra | Brand of hat |
| Amber Nectar | Beer |
| Ambo | Ambulance or Ambulance Officer |
| Ankle-biter | Infant |
| ANZAC | Australian & New Zealand Army Corps |
| Arvo | Afternoon |
| Bail Up | To rob or hold up; bail someone up in the street for a chat |
| Barbie | Barbeque, the backyard barbie, an Australian institution! |
| Barney | Argument,fight |
| Barrack | Cheer loudly for your favourite footy team |
| Bathers | Swimsuit |
| Battler | Someone who struggles to get by, financially |
| Beanie | Woollen hat |
| Beaut | Beautiful, good |
| Biffo | A fight |
| Big bikkies | Lots of money |
| Bikey | Motorbike rider |
| Bikkie | Biscuit |
| Billabong | Waterhole |
| Billy | Tin used to boil water for tea, in the bush |
| Bingle | Car accident |
| Bit of a brothel | A mess! |
| Bities | Biting insects |
| Bitser | Mongrel;'Bitser this, bitser that!' |
| Bizzo | Business |
| Black Stump | Non-specific place in the outback |
| Bloke | Man,guy |
| Blotto | Drunk |
| Blow-in | Newcomer |
| Blowie | Blowfly |
| Bludger | Lazy person |
| Blue | Argument, fight |
| Bluey | A redhead! |
| Blundstones | Elastic-sided workman's boots |
| Bonza | Great! |
| Boofhead | Idiot |
| Bottleshop | Liquor store, off-licence |
| Bozo | Idiot |
| Brekkie | Breakfast |
| Brissie | Brisbane,Capital of Queensland |
| Buckley's | No chance! |
| Buck's night | Stag party |
| Bunch of Fives | Fist |
| Bundy | Dark rum from Bundaburg,Queensland, sugar cane region |
| Bunyip | Mythical Australian creature with a piercing cry |
| Burl | Attempt, try |
| Bush | Outside the city |
| Bushranger | Highwayman (eg. Ned Kelly) |
| Bush Telegraph | 'Grapevine', word-ofmouth |
| Bush tucker | Food gathered from nature, in the outback |
| Bushwalking | Hiking in the bush |
| Cack | A cackle, have a laugh, or someone with a sense of humour! |
| Cask | Boxed wine in a bladder |
| Cheerio | Cocktail sausage |
| Cherry Ripe | Chocolate-coated cherry bar |
| Choof off | Leave, depart |
| Chook | Chicken, term of affection, 'Chooky' |
| Chuck | To throw, or be sick |
| Chuck a spas | Be angry |
| Chuck a U-ie | Make a U-turn |
| Chunder | Be sick, vomit |
| Cobber | Mate, friend |
| Cockie | Cockroach or Cockatoo |
| Cooee | A call used to find someone lost in the bush |
| Cop out | Give up or in |
| Cossie | Swimsuit |
| Couch Potato | Person who watches TV for long periods of time! |
| Crash | Go to sleep, often at someone else's house! |
| Crim | Criminal |
| Crook | Ill, sick (or thief) |
| Crumblies | Elderly parents |
| Cuppa | Cup of tea |
| Cushie | To have it easy |
| Cut lunch | Sandwiches |
| Dag | Idiot, or unfashionable person, 'daggy' |
| Daks | Men's trousers |
| Damper | Bread made from flour and water on a campfire in the bush |
| Deadcert | Definite, certain |
| Deadhead | Good-for-nothing person |
| Deadset | Truthful |
| Dekko | Take a look |
| Dero | Homeless person, derilict, hobo |
| Digger | Australian soldier (usually WW1 vets) |
| Dill | Idiot |
| Dinkie-Di | Genuine, honest |
| Dob in | Inform on someone |
| Drizabone | Brand of waterproof wax coat |
| Drongo | Idiot |
| Duck's dinner | Drink of water, with nothing to eat |
| Dunny | Toilet, referring to the old outdoor variety |
| Earbash | Non-stop chatter |
| Ekka | Exhibition |
| Esky | Insulated cooler box |
| Exsie | Expensive |
| Fair dinkum | Good, honest, truthful |
| Fair go | Reasonable chance |
| Fang | Snack, lunch |
| Fang it | Drive fast (inspired by Fangio) |
| Footie | Regional term for either Australian Rules Football, or Rugby League! |
| Freddo Frog | Small frog-shaped chocolate bar for children |
| Freshie | Freshwater crocodile |
| G'day | Greeting, hello! (good day to you!) |
| Galah | Noisy, rude person, like the squawking bird |
| Garbo | Garbageman, refuse collector, binman |
| Gerrie | Geriatric, old person |
| God botherer | Religious fanatic (of the door-todoor variety!) |
| Goodonyermate! | Good for you, well done! |
| Good nick | Good condition |
| Goog | Egg |
| Greenie | Environmentalist |
| Grog | Alcohol |
| Grommet | Young surfer |
| Grotty | Run-down, dirty |
| Grouse | Very good, cool! |
| Gurgler | Plughole |
| Half your luck! | Congratulations! |
| Hard yakka | Hard work |
| Heart-starter | First alcoholic drink of the day |
| Heave | To vomit |
| Holy-dooly | Expression of suprise |
| Hoo-roo | Goodbye |
| Hoon | Loudmouth, to drive recklessly! |
| Hostie | Air hostess, flight attendant |
| Hotel | Pub, with or without accommodation |
| Icypole | Frozen lolly |
| Idiot box | Television |
| Jackaroo | Cattle or Sheep Stationhand |
| Jaffa | Orange-flavoured chocolate ball, with hard orange coating. Traditionally rolled down the cinema aisle! |
| Jaffle iron | Camping tool, used to make a toasted sandwich |
| Jillaroo | Female Cattle or Sheep Stationhand |
| Jocks | Mens underpants |
| Joe Blow | Mr. Average |
| Joey | Baby Kangaroo |
| Journo | Journalist |
| Jumbuck | Young sheep |
| Kark it | Die |
| Kindie | Kindergarten |
| Knock | Criticise |
| Knuckle sandwich | A punch! |
| Lamington | Small square of sponge cake covered in chocolate icing, and dessicated coconut |
| Lay-by | Store system of paying for goods in instalments |
| Lippie | Lipstick |
| Lolly | Sweets, candy |
| Longneck | Tall bottle of beer, 750ml or 26oz |
| Lucky Country | Nickname for Australia |
| Lurk | Illegal practice, dodge, racket |
| Manchester | Linen |
| Mate | Friend, used instead of someone's name! |
| Mates rates | Discount rates given to friends |
| Middy | Glass of beer, 285ml or 10oz, in NSW/ACT & WA |
| Mozzie | Mosquito |
| Never Never | Remote outback place |
| No worries! | It's OK, everything's fine! |
| Nong | Idiot |
| Norks | Breasts |
| Nut ducker | Person who pretends not to see you in the street! |
| O.S. | Overseas |
| Ocker | Yob |
| Old cheese | Mother |
| Olds | Parents |
| Osteo | Osteopath |
| Outback | Remote bush location |
| Oz | Nickname for Australia |
| Pash | Kiss, 'Pash-on' |
| Pav | Pavlova-Australian desert; a meringue base with fruit and cream topping |
| Pavement pizza | Vomit |
| Perve | Lustful gaze |
| Piker | Bore, party pooper: 'Pike out'-To leave the party early! |
| Play sillybuggers | Waste time, mess around |
| Plonk | Cheap wine |
| Pokies | Poker machines, slot or fruit machines |
| Postie | Person who delivers mail |
| Pot | Glass of beer, 285ml or 10oz, in QLD & VIC |
| Pozzie | Position, seat |
| Queensland Nut | Macadamia nut |
| Quids in | Have some money left |
| R.S.L. | Returned Services League-Social club, good place to play pool or have a counter lunch |
| Rage | To party on |
| Rapt | Pleased |
| Rellies | Relatives |
| Ridgy-didge | Genuine, honest |
| Ripper | Great! |
| Road-train | -Long semi-trailer used to transport livestock over great distances |
| Roo | Kangaroo |
| Rugged up | Dressed in warm clothes |
| Rugrat | Baby |
| Saltie | Saltwater Crocodile |
| Salvo | Salvation Army worker |
| Schoolies' Week | End-of-school parties, especially held at the Gold Coast; usually = fun/trouble! |
| Schooner | Glass of beer, 425ml in NSW/ACT,NT & WA |
| Shoot through | Leave |
| Shout | Round of beer/drinks |
| Sickie | Paid day off work, usually not due to illness; "I'm gonna chucka sickie tomorra" |
| Singlet | Sleeveless t-shirt or vest |
| Sleep-out | Rear porch of house converted to extra bedroom |
| Smoko | Workbreak, to have a cigarette, or cup of tea/coffee |
| Snag | Sausage |
| Snakey | Irritable |
| Sook | Crybaby |
| Spag Bog | Spaghetti Bolognaise |
| Sparrow's fart | Dawn |
| Special | Discounted item in a store |
| Speedos | Men's swimming pants |
| Spewing | Very upset, really mad! (also vomit) |
| Spit the dummy | Uncontrollably upset |
| Spunky | Good-looking,'hot'! |
| Sprogs | Offspring, children |
| Squiz | Have a look at |
| Station | Large outback farm |
| Stickybeak | Nosey person |
| Stinger | Box jellyfish |
| Stormstick | Umbrella |
| Straight-up | Truthful, honest |
| Strife | Trouble |
| Stubbies | Men's shorts or bottles of beer |
| Stubby Holder | Insulated holder to keep beer cool |
| Sucked in | Duped, conned |
| Sunnies | Sunglasses |
| T.A.B. | Totalisator Agency Board betting shop |
| Tassie | Tasmania |
| Technicolour Yawn | To vomit |
| The Alice | Alice Springs |
| The Gong | Woollongong |
| Thingo | The word you substitute the name of something or someone you've forgotten! |
| Thongs | Rubber sandals, flip-flops |
| TimTam | Chocolate sandwich biscuit, coated in chocolate. YUM! |
| Tinnie | Can of beer |
| Toey | Nervous |
| Troppo | Slighty mad, from being in the sun too long |
| True blue | Genuinely Australian |
| Tub | Bath, but also refers to shower |
| Tucker | Food |
| Tucker chute | Mouth |
| Twisties | Cheese-flavoured twist-shape crisps |
| Two-up | Gambling game involving throwing two coins in the air from a holder |
| Uggies | Ugg boots-sheepskin boots or slippers (UGly! 'daggy'!) |
| Undies | Underwear |
| Unit | Flat, condominium |
| Unreal! | Excellent! |
| Up yourself | Inflated ego |
| Ute | Utility van with tray top, used by tradesmen |
| Vegemite | Yeast spread; An acquired taste, useful hangover cure! |
| Veg out | Relax |
| Veggies | Vegetable |
| Violet Crumble | Chocolate-coated honeycomb bar |
| Walkabout | Disappeared, gone on long walk |
| Westie | Person from Western suburbs of Sydney |
| Wharfie | Dock-worker |
| Windies | West Indian Cricket Team |
| Wino | Alcoholic |
| Within cooee | Close by, in hearing distance |
| Wowser | Killjoy, party pooper |
| XXXX | Pronounced "Four-ex" not "ex-ex-exex!" Famous Qld beer |
| Yabber | Chat |
| Yabbie | Crayfish |
| Yahoo | Noisy, unruly person |
| Yobbo | Loudmouth |
| Yodel | Vomit |
| You beaut | Wonderful! |
| Zeds | Sleep; 'stack some Zzzz's' |
| Ziff | Beard |
| Zonked | Exhausted |
